Test principle

The test principle applied in this kit is Sandwich enzyme immunoassay. The microtiter plate provided in this kit has been pre-coated with an antibody specific to Rabbit GFAP. Standards or samples are added to the appropriate microtiter plate wells then with a biotin-conjugated antibody specific to Rabbit GFAP. Next, Avidin conjugated to Horseradish Peroxidase (HRP) is added to each microplate well and incubated. After TMB substrate solution is added, only those wells that contain Rabbit GFAP, biotin-conjugated antibody and enzyme-conjugated Avidin will exhibit a change in color. The enzyme-substrate reaction is terminated by the addition of sulphuric acid solution and the color change is measured spectrophotometrically at a wavelength of 450nm ± 10nm. The concentration of Rabbit GFAP in the samples is then determined by comparing the OD of the samples to the standard curve.

Research target context

GFAPglial fibrillary acidic protein

View target guide

GFAP identifies glial fibrillary acidic protein in Homo sapiens (Human). This target record connects NCBI Gene 2670, UniProtKB P14136 and related ABMIUM catalogue products.

Biological function: GFAP is a class III intermediate-filament protein expressed prominently in astrocytes and other glial populations. It contributes to cytoskeletal organisation, maintenance of cell structure and glial responses to injury or stress.
